├── .gitattributes ├── .github └── stale.yml ├── .gitignore ├── LICENSE.txt ├── README.md ├── __init__.py ├── bounding_box_utils ├── __init__.py └── bounding_box_utils.py ├── data_augmentation_chains ├── __init__.py ├── data_augmentation_chain_constant_input_size.py ├── data_augmentation_chain_original_ssd.py ├── data_augmentation_chain_satellite.py └── data_augmentation_chain_variable_input_size.py ├── data_generator_tutorial.ipynb ├── examples ├── image01_original.png ├── image01_processed01.png ├── image01_processed02.png └── image01_processed03.png ├── misc_utils └── object_detection_2d_misc_utils.py ├── object_detection_2d_data_generator.py ├── ssd_encoder_decoder ├── __init__.py ├── matching_utils.py └── ssd_input_encoder.py ├── transformations ├── __init__.py ├── object_detection_2d_geometric_ops.py ├── object_detection_2d_image_boxes_validation_utils.py ├── object_detection_2d_patch_sampling_ops.py └── object_detection_2d_photometric_ops.py └── tutorial_dataset ├── Annotations ├── 000030.xml ├── 000050.xml ├── 000080.xml ├── 000081.xml ├── 000107.xml ├── 000115.xml ├── 000137.xml └── 000176.xml ├── ImageSets └── imageset.txt └── JPEGImages ├── 000030.jpg ├── 000050.jpg ├── 000080.jpg ├── 000081.jpg ├── 000107.jpg ├── 000115.jpg ├── 000137.jpg └── 000176.jpg /.gitattributes: -------------------------------------------------------------------------------- 1 | *.ipynb linguist-language=Python 2 | -------------------------------------------------------------------------------- /.github/stale.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/.github/stale.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/.gitignore -------------------------------------------------------------------------------- /LICENSE.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/LICENSE.txt -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/README.md -------------------------------------------------------------------------------- /__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/bounding_box_utils/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/bounding_box_utils/bounding_box_utils.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/bounding_box_utils/bounding_box_utils.py -------------------------------------------------------------------------------- /data_augmentation_chains/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/data_augmentation_chains/data_augmentation_chain_constant_input_size.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/data_augmentation_chains/data_augmentation_chain_constant_input_size.py -------------------------------------------------------------------------------- /data_augmentation_chains/data_augmentation_chain_original_ssd.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/data_augmentation_chains/data_augmentation_chain_original_ssd.py -------------------------------------------------------------------------------- /data_augmentation_chains/data_augmentation_chain_satellite.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/data_augmentation_chains/data_augmentation_chain_satellite.py -------------------------------------------------------------------------------- /data_augmentation_chains/data_augmentation_chain_variable_input_size.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/data_augmentation_chains/data_augmentation_chain_variable_input_size.py -------------------------------------------------------------------------------- /data_generator_tutorial.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/data_generator_tutorial.ipynb -------------------------------------------------------------------------------- /examples/image01_original.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/examples/image01_original.png -------------------------------------------------------------------------------- /examples/image01_processed01.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/examples/image01_processed01.png -------------------------------------------------------------------------------- /examples/image01_processed02.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/examples/image01_processed02.png -------------------------------------------------------------------------------- /examples/image01_processed03.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/examples/image01_processed03.png -------------------------------------------------------------------------------- /misc_utils/object_detection_2d_misc_utils.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/misc_utils/object_detection_2d_misc_utils.py -------------------------------------------------------------------------------- /object_detection_2d_data_generator.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/object_detection_2d_data_generator.py -------------------------------------------------------------------------------- /ssd_encoder_decoder/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/ssd_encoder_decoder/matching_utils.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/ssd_encoder_decoder/matching_utils.py -------------------------------------------------------------------------------- /ssd_encoder_decoder/ssd_input_encoder.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/ssd_encoder_decoder/ssd_input_encoder.py -------------------------------------------------------------------------------- /transformations/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/transformations/object_detection_2d_geometric_ops.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/transformations/object_detection_2d_geometric_ops.py -------------------------------------------------------------------------------- /transformations/object_detection_2d_image_boxes_validation_utils.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/transformations/object_detection_2d_image_boxes_validation_utils.py -------------------------------------------------------------------------------- /transformations/object_detection_2d_patch_sampling_ops.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/transformations/object_detection_2d_patch_sampling_ops.py -------------------------------------------------------------------------------- /transformations/object_detection_2d_photometric_ops.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/transformations/object_detection_2d_photometric_ops.py -------------------------------------------------------------------------------- /tutorial_dataset/Annotations/000030.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/Annotations/000030.xml -------------------------------------------------------------------------------- /tutorial_dataset/Annotations/000050.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/Annotations/000050.xml -------------------------------------------------------------------------------- /tutorial_dataset/Annotations/000080.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/Annotations/000080.xml -------------------------------------------------------------------------------- /tutorial_dataset/Annotations/000081.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/Annotations/000081.xml -------------------------------------------------------------------------------- /tutorial_dataset/Annotations/000107.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/Annotations/000107.xml -------------------------------------------------------------------------------- /tutorial_dataset/Annotations/000115.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/Annotations/000115.xml -------------------------------------------------------------------------------- /tutorial_dataset/Annotations/000137.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/Annotations/000137.xml -------------------------------------------------------------------------------- /tutorial_dataset/Annotations/000176.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/Annotations/000176.xml -------------------------------------------------------------------------------- /tutorial_dataset/ImageSets/imageset.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/ImageSets/imageset.txt -------------------------------------------------------------------------------- /tutorial_dataset/JPEGImages/000030.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/JPEGImages/000030.jpg -------------------------------------------------------------------------------- /tutorial_dataset/JPEGImages/000050.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/JPEGImages/000050.jpg -------------------------------------------------------------------------------- /tutorial_dataset/JPEGImages/000080.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/JPEGImages/000080.jpg -------------------------------------------------------------------------------- /tutorial_dataset/JPEGImages/000081.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/JPEGImages/000081.jpg -------------------------------------------------------------------------------- /tutorial_dataset/JPEGImages/000107.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/JPEGImages/000107.jpg -------------------------------------------------------------------------------- /tutorial_dataset/JPEGImages/000115.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/JPEGImages/000115.jpg -------------------------------------------------------------------------------- /tutorial_dataset/JPEGImages/000137.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/JPEGImages/000137.jpg -------------------------------------------------------------------------------- /tutorial_dataset/JPEGImages/000176.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pierluigiferrari/data_generator_object_detection_2d/HEAD/tutorial_dataset/JPEGImages/000176.jpg --------------------------------------------------------------------------------